description Product Description
Sodium methanethiosulfonate is widely used in biochemical research, particularly in protein studies. It serves as a modifying agent for cysteine residues in proteins, enabling the introduction of specific functional groups or labels. This chemical is valuable in site-directed mutagenesis and protein engineering, allowing researchers to investigate protein structure, function, and interactions. Additionally, it is employed in the study of enzyme mechanisms and the development of bioconjugates for therapeutic and diagnostic applications. Its ability to selectively modify thiol groups makes it a key tool in understanding redox processes and cellular signaling pathways.
